Executive Financial Report: Chewelah (99109)

Evaluating relocation options in Stevens? The financial baseline for residing in Chewelah, WA (99109) indicates that a single adult needs roughly $2,857 monthly to cover basic survival expenses.

With typical rent and housing utilities averaging an affordable $570 per month—just 20% of baseline expenses—Chewelah offers exceptionally competitive shelter costs compared to wider metropolitan averages across Washington.

To maintain sustainable financial health in Chewelah (99109) using the popular 50/30/20 budgeting framework, your essential living expenses ($2,857/month) should not exceed 50% of your net take-home pay. Consequently, an individual needs a target gross annual salary of approximately $68,568 to cover necessities while building savings. On an hourly basis, working a standard 2,080-hour work year requires a minimum hourly living wage of $16.48/hour just to meet basic survival costs.

For a family of four (2 adults and 2 children), basic monthly expenditures in Chewelah increase to $6,249 per month ($74,988/year)—approximately 2.2x higher than the single-adult baseline. Childcare premiums and multi-bedroom housing represent the largest contributors to this family budget increase. Compared against the area median family income of $65,764, local wages provide a 1.92x coverage ratio relative to single-adult baseline expenses.

Commuting and transit expenses average $1,016 monthly in 99109, coupled with $323 in healthcare baselines. Tax obligations consume $368 monthly.
